Discover the Thrilling Race to Build an Iconic Skyline

Step into the captivating world of architectural rivalry with ‘Higher: A Historic Race to the Sky and the Making of a City’ by Neal Bascomb. This book takes you back to the roaring 1920s, when visionary architects and bold entrepreneurs competed to redefine the limits of human engineering. If you love history, art, and ambition, this is for you.

The Stories Behind the Concrete and Steel

Delve into the challenges faced by the minds behind iconic buildings like the Chrysler and Empire State buildings. Neal Bascomb balances detailed research with gripping storytelling, revealing the drama that unfolded during the race for the tallest skyscraper. Each page shines a light on creativity and fierce determination, making it more than just historical documentation – it’s an inspiring narrative.
